About 313 S Trail Trail Unit A

Fully Renovated Cooper Model in Oronoque Village | 3 Parking Spaces Completely renovated Cooper Model in the heart of Oronoque Village, Stratford's premier 55+ adult community. This stunning 2 Bedroom + condo has been completely transformed from top to bottom, blending modern luxury with timeless comfort. Step into a bright, open-concept living & dining area featuring new White Oak hardwood floors, vaulted ceiling and a cozy wood-burning fireplace. A brand-new chef's kitchen with striking black marble countertops, custom maple cabinetry, and sleek finishes perfect for entertaining or daily living. Spacious primary bedroom, walk-in closet and ensuite bath. The second bedroom could also double as the perfect office or creative space-opens to one of two private decks, offering serene views of the private backyard. The lower level features a spacious multi-purpose family room with kitchenette, a full renovated bath, laundry area, and a cozy sitting room-perfect for guests. A standout feature of this unit is the rare three-car parking configuration: Two reserved driveway spots right at your front door, plus An additional private garage spot-a highly sought-after amenity in Oronoque Village! Beautifully landscaped, active adult community, residents enjoy access to a newly renovated clubhouse, pools, tennis courts, fitness center, and full social calendar of events. Living in Stratford, CT

Transportation in Stratford is facilitated by a network of roads and highways, including access to major routes that make commuting to nearby cities convenient. Public transportation options are available, providing residents with alternatives to private vehicle use. The town also features areas that are pedestrian-friendly, encouraging walking and biking as viable modes of transport. While ride-sharing services are present, they complement the existing transportation infrastructure, offering additional flexibility for residents and visitors.

The town of Stratford is served by a solid educational system, including several public schools that cater to students from kindergarten through high school, as well as private educational options. Healthcare needs are met by nearby hospitals and clinics that offer a range of services from routine care to specialized treatments. The community also enjoys access to public libraries and a variety of retail and dining options that reflect the local culture. City initiatives are in place to continually improve these services to meet the evolving needs of Stratford's diverse population.

Stratford is known for its community-oriented atmosphere and scenic beauty, with numerous parks and beaches that enhance the quality of life for its residents. The town prides itself on its rich history and cultural events, including the annual Stratford Festival, which brings together the community in celebration of local arts and performances. The blend of suburban tranquility and active community life creates a balanced environment that appeals to families and individuals alike.

Stratford's housing market is diverse, offering a range of options from charming single-family homes to convenient apartment complexes and townhouses. The architectural styles vary, with a notable presence of colonial and cape cod homes that reflect the area's historical roots. A significant portion of the housing stock was developed in the mid-20th century, providing a sense of established community. The homeownership rate in Stratford is robust, with a majority of residents owning their homes, while a smaller yet substantial segment of the population opts for renting.
